What Makes an Office Furniture Manufacturer “Sustainable”?

A sustainable office furniture manufacturer is one that can document environmental compliance across materials, emissions, and supply chain traceability using named certifications with numeric thresholds.

The Three Certifications That Matter

Certification What It Verifies Key Numeric Standard
FSC Chain-of-Custody (FSC-CoC) Full timber traceability from forest to finished product 100% of certified wood tracked through every production stage
GREENGUARD Gold Low chemical emissions for indoor air quality TVOC ≤ 0.22 mg/m³
Cradle to Cradle Certified® Circular design and material health Bronze, Silver, Gold, or Platinum tiers

According to the Forest Stewardship Council, FSC-CoC certification requires that every facility handling certified timber maintains a documented chain from certified forest to final product. Any break in that chain voids the claim.

GREENGUARD Gold certification, administered by UL Solutions, sets a Total Volatile Organic Compounds (TVOC) limit of 0.22 mg/m³. Products meeting this standard qualify for LEED v4.1 EQc low-emitting materials credits.

Cradle to Cradle Certified® evaluates five categories: material health, product circularity, clean air and climate protection, water and soil stewardship, and social fairness. Products earn Bronze, Silver, Gold, or Platinum tiers depending on cumulative scores.

Why “Sustainable” Alone Is Not Enough

A supplier claiming sustainability without naming a certification body provides no verifiable data. Request the actual certificate number and verify it with the issuing body—FSC, UL, or C2C—before shortlisting a factory.


How to Verify Durability in Office Furniture

Durability in office furniture is measured by standardized mechanical testing, not by warranty length or material weight alone.

BIFMA Testing Protocols

Standard Product Type Test Requirement
ANSI/BIFMA X5.1 Office seating Backrest 200,000-cycle test; seat impact 100,000 cycles
ANSI/BIFMA X5.5 Desk products Top static load ≥ 90 kg
ANSI/BIFMA X5.9 Storage units Cycle and load testing for drawers, hinges, and casters

Per ANSI/BIFMA X5.1, a task chair’s backrest must survive 200,000 cycles of rearward force application. The seat must withstand 100,000 cycles of impact testing, simulating years of sitting and rising. These are mechanical tests conducted by accredited laboratories, not factory self-assessments.

Desks tested to ANSI/BIFMA X5.5 must support a distributed static top load of at least 90 kg without structural failure. This covers typical monitor-and-equipment loads but also accounts for occasional leaning weight.

The Class 4 Gas Cylinder Standard

Class 4 pneumatic gas cylinders, rated for user weight up to 150 kg, are a BIFMA-certified component standard for task chairs. According to BIFMA X5.1, the gas cylinder must not fail during the full cycle test sequence. When a supplier specifies “Class 4 cylinder,” request the BIFMA test report for that specific component.

Red Flags in Durability Claims

“BIFMA-tested” without a named laboratory or test report number
Warranty terms that exceed the tested cycle life of key components
No documentation of component-level testing (gas cylinders, casters, armrests)


Sourcing Sustainable Furniture from China: What to Request

Sourcing sustainable office furniture from a Chinese manufacturer requires a documentation list that goes beyond the commercial invoice.

The Five-Document Checklist


BIFMA test reports — named laboratory, test method, and date
FSC-CoC certificate — valid for your specific product line and factory
GREENGUARD Gold certificate — product-specific, not factory-wide
Third-party inspection report — SGS, Bureau Veritas, or Intertek, photo-documented
Incoterms 2020 quote — FOB, CIF, CFR, or DDP with named port

Under Incoterms 2020, an FOB quote covers goods delivered and loaded on the vessel, but not inland trucking, port handling, or destination clearance. Buyers should calculate that FOB pricing will carry 8–12% in additional landed costs once these factors are included.

For LEED v4.1 EQc or BREEAM credit projects, FSC-CoC documentation is non-negotiable. Without it, the project cannot claim certified wood credits.

The 2026 Sourcing Reality

CBRE data from 2024 shows average space-per-person in the tech sector at 8.5 m², down from a global average that declined approximately 28% from 2010 to 2024 according to CoreNet Global research. This density increase means furniture undergoes more frequent use cycles per day. Durability certification becomes more critical, not less, as workstation occupancy rises.


OEM vs. ODM vs. OBM: Which Sourcing Model Fits?

O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turing), ODM (Original Design Manufacturing), and OBM (Own Brand Manufacturing) are three distinct sourcing models with different implications for sustainability verification.

OEM: Your Design, Their Factory

The buyer provides designs and specifications; the factory manufactures to those drawings. Sustainability certification responsibility rests with the buyer to specify materials and standards. The factory must document compliance, but the buyer’s design determines whether FSC or GREENGUARD certification is achievable.

ODM: Factory Design, Your Brand

The manufacturer’s existing product line is rebranded. For sustainable sourcing, ODM is the fastest route because the factory’s certifications already cover the product. Request the full certification package before sample approval.

OBM: Factory Brand, Factory Standards

The manufacturer’s own brand carries the sustainability claims. This model requires the most trust in the factory’s certification program, since the buyer has no design input.

For 2026 projects, all three models are viable, but the verification burden differs substantially. OEM requires the buyer to audit material specifications; ODM and OBM shift verification to the manufacturer’s existing certification portfolio.

FAQ

Q: What is the difference between FSC and FSC-CoC certification?

FSC certifies forests; FSC-CoC certifies every facility in the supply chain that handles certified timber. A factory needs FSC-CoC to legally label products as containing FSC-certified wood.

Q: How long does GREENGUARD Gold certification last?

Certification is valid for one year and requires annual renewal with retesting. Always verify that a supplier’s certificate is current, not expired.

Q: Can a single factory hold BIFMA, FSC, and GREENGUARD certifications?

Yes, but each certification is independent. BIFMA covers mechanical testing, FSC covers timber traceability, and GREENGUARD covers chemical emissions. Verify each separately.

Q: What does “Class 4 cylinder” mean on an office chair?

A Class 4 pneumatic gas cylinder is rated to support user weight up to 150 kg per BIFMA X5.1. It is the standard component specification for task chairs.

Q: How do I calculate landed cost from an FOB quote?

Per Incoterms 2020, FOB covers goods loaded on the vessel. Budget 8–12% additional for inland trucking, port handling, and destination clearance, and compare DDP quotes when delivery cost certainty matters.
